Reclaimed Concrete Material Material Description ORIGIN Two billion tons of aggregate are produced every year in the US. Production of aggregate is expected to reach billion tons by 2020, which raises concerns about where the new aggregate will come from. (5) One alternative to using aggregate is recycled concrete aggregate ...

According to WBDG — a program of the National Institute of Building Sciences — by recycling concrete, you help reduce construction waste, extend the life of landfills, save builders disposal or tipping fees, and reduce transportation costs since concrete can usually be recycled on site. The grade of concrete has little or no effect on the frictional performance of the recycled concrete aggregate used in facing units. • The use of recycled aggregate GRSRWs minimizes concrete waste and is sustainable. Recycled concrete aggregates (RCAs) are an alternative infill material for used for segmental regaining walls.

Jul 22, 2015· Concrete disposal is difficult and even dangerous because it is heavy and unwieldy. Even transporting concrete debris can be a challenge. Unlike other construction waste materials, or CD waste, concrete has both additional considerations for hauling and disposal, but it also provides additional opportunities for recycling.

Recycled concrete and masonry (RCM) aggregate can be described as graded aggregate produced from sorted and clean waste concrete and masonry. The RCM material may contain brick, gravel crush rock or other forms of stony materials as blended materials.
